在互联网技术飞速发展的今天,PHP作为一种广泛使用的开源脚本语言,因其强大的功能和灵活性,成为了许多开发者首选的语言之一。而当我们提到ThinkPHP时,它不仅仅是一个简单的PHP框架,更是一种开发理念与实践的结合体。
ThinkPHP简介
ThinkPHP 是一个快速、简单且高效的 PHP 开发框架,它为开发者提供了丰富的工具集和模块化设计,使得构建复杂的 Web 应用程序变得更加容易。从最初版本发布以来,ThinkPHP 已经经过了多次迭代更新,不断优化性能并增加新特性,以满足日益增长的市场需求。
为什么选择ThinkPHP?
1. 高效开发
ThinkPHP 提供了完整的 MVC(Model-View-Controller)架构支持,让程序员能够专注于业务逻辑而非基础设置。通过内置的功能组件如路由管理、数据库操作等,可以显著提高项目的开发效率。
2. 灵活扩展
框架本身具备良好的可扩展性,用户可以根据实际需求自由添加或修改功能模块。无论是小型项目还是大型企业级应用,都可以找到适合自己的解决方案。
3. 社区活跃
ThinkPHP 拥有一个庞大且积极活跃的社区,在这里你可以轻松获取帮助、分享经验或者参与到项目的改进中来。这种开放的合作氛围对于任何想要深入学习的人来说都是非常宝贵的资源。
4. 跨平台兼容性
不论是 Windows、Linux 还是 macOS 等操作系统环境下运行,ThinkPHP 都能保持稳定的表现,确保你的应用程序能够在不同环境中无缝切换。
ThinkPHP的特点
- 轻量级:尽管功能强大,但它的体积却非常小巧,加载速度快。
- 安全性强:内置了许多安全机制来防止常见的攻击手段,比如 SQL 注入、XSS 跨站脚本攻击等。
- 多数据库支持:支持 MySQL、SQLite、PostgreSQL等多种主流数据库类型。
- 国际化友好:自带多语言包,方便进行全球化部署。
总结
综上所述,“ThinkPHP 是什么”这个问题的答案远不止于一个框架那么简单。它是无数开发者智慧结晶的体现,是一个能够激发创造力、促进团队协作的强大工具。如果你正在寻找一款既能简化工作流程又能保证质量的 PHP 框架,那么 ThinkPHP 绝对值得你去尝试!
希望这篇文章对你有所帮助,也欢迎大家继续关注更多关于编程技术的文章!


